Vacuum Oil was founded in 1866 by Matthew Ewing and Hiram Bond Everest, from Rochester, New York. The lubricating oil was an accidental discovery; while trying to distill kerosene, Everest noted that the residue from the extraction was suitable as a lubricant. Soon after, the product became popular for use in steam engines and internal combustion engines. Ewing sold his stake to Everest, who continued with the company.
